
However, now that we've had some hands-on time with it, it's clear that this first impression is unfair. At first glance, it looked like a lower-end Curve 9360 that had been confusingly dressed up to look more like its flagship brother, the Bold 9900/9930. Then, of course, there was the strangely familiar nature of the BB OS 7 handset itself. For a start, RIM selected Indonesia for the smartphone's launch event and first availability - it won't be reaching stores here until early 2012, which is an interesting move by the manufacturer to reflect its globalized market. Since its launch earlier today, the Bold 9790 has been a device of curious beginnings.
